WebCodon usage bias refers to differences in the frequency of occurrence of synonymous codons in coding DNA. WebNov 1, 2024 · Codon usage bias can therfore be used to predict the relative expression levels of genes, by comparing CU bias of a gene to the CU bias of a set of genes known to be highly expressed.
